Chemonics seeks a Chief of Party for the anticipated five-year USAID funded Low Cost Private Schools (LCPS) Activity in Ghana. The purpose of the activity is to enable proprietors, teachers, communities, financial organizations, professional networks, and the Government of Ghana (GoG) to improve student learning outcomes and financing options for LCPSs. The activity is focused on select LCPSs in the USAID Global Food Security Strategy (GFSS) Zone of Influence (ZOI)1 in northern Ghana. This position will be based in Ghana.
